Stoical yet sad, Foppa's Virgin and Child betrays traces of Gothic intensity but the powerfully blocked out forms of mother and Child point to new developments initiated by Fra Filippo Lippi and followed by Piero della Francesca and Mantegna. Here Mary and Jesus take on the roles of the new, redemptive Adam and Eve, symbolized by the Virgin holding a fruit for her Son's taking.
